How is private respite care different from other forms of elderly care?

Private respite care stands out distinctly from other forms of elderly care like supported living. The primary distinction lies in its temporal nature; private respite care is designed to be a temporary arrangement, structured to afford family caregivers an interval for rest and relief.

On the contrary, supported living offers a more permanent solution, providing a long-term residency for the elderly. One of the other significant differences between these two types of elderly care is the location where the care takes place.

With private respite care, the service can conveniently be performed in the comfort of one's own home. This is often very comforting to your loved ones, and can offer peace of mind, as the familiar surroundings may lessen feelings of disorientation or confusion often associated with new environments.

By contrast with supported living, the care takes place in a communal residence away from the elderly person's house. Another distinguishing factor that sets private respite care apart is the personalised degree of personal attention it gives.

Carers in respite services usually offer round-the-clock personalised services tailored to meet the exact needs of each individual. This can be incredibly beneficial for elderly individuals who have specific, unique requirements.

On the other hand, supported living typically presents a broad spectrum of activities catering to a wider audience, which may not necessarily suit everyone's individual needs or preferences. To sum up, private respite care provides adaptable support and flexibility, which can be exceptionally beneficial in today's fast-paced lifestyle and considering the vastly diversified needs of our elderly loved ones. Therefore, depending on your personal circumstances and unique requirements, private respite care can present a more fitting option.

What services do private respite carers offer?

Private respite carers offer a range of significant services that prove invaluable to both elderly individuals and their families.

Personal Care Assistance

Primarily, private respite carers offer invaluable personal care assistance. This involves an extensive range of daily activities including, but not limited to bathing, dressing, and preparing meals.

By delivering such a substantial service, it's ensured that the personal needs of elderly individuals are fully met in a respectful and dignified manner. One of the major advantages of private respite carers is the huge strand of relief they provide to family members.

Undoubtedly, this helps avoid unnecessary stress and strain on family resources. Plus, it gives family members confidence, knowing their loved ones are receiving high-level, professional care, tailored to their unique needs. The contribution of private respite carers cannot be underestimated, given the deeply personal and professional way they address the needs of elderly people. Their role offers not just assistance, but also companionship, contributing to the overall well-being of those they care for.

Companionship and Emotional Support

Private respite carers go beyond just providing physical care and assistance. Within their role, they also extend companionship and emotional support, offering a sense of comfort to the individuals they are assisting.

By engaging our loved ones in stimulating conversations and involving them in a variety of activities, they create a nurturing and positive environment. This one-on-one interaction forms a vital component of the care provided. It encourages connections, helping to combat feelings of loneliness and isolation that can often come alongside certain situations.

Medication Management

Medication management is a key service provided by private respite carers. The role of these professional carers is vital, they make certain that the correct medication is taken as directed. Precision with medicines is critical in the care of the elderly, thus reducing risks tied to medication errors.

The pressure and uncertainty of administering medication can be overwhelming when caring for the elderly alone. However, with the presence of an experienced private respite carer, this burden is significantly lessened.

How can I find a reliable private respite care provider?

Finding a reliable private respite care provider is of utmost importance to guarantee the well-being and safety of your loved one. This vital task can be initiated by conducting comprehensive research. Make use of the internet's vast resources to collate data about various service providers in your locality.

It's crucial to scrutinise their offered services, reputation in the market, and the cost associated with their care. The internet provides an abundance of reviews and testimonials from previous clients who have used the services of these care providers. Take note of these, they will provide an unbiased view which can be essential when choosing a provider.

Additionally, it's worth arranging personal interviews with the potential care providers. This will not only give you an opportunity to meet them in person but will also allow you to assess their aptitude. Ask pertinent questions about their professional training, qualifications, experience, and the care methods they employ. These interviews could be incredibly informative and play a decisive role in choosing the right provider.

Lastly, do not underestimate the value of recommendations and personal experiences. Find time to reach out to your friends, family members or healthcare professionals you trust. They may be able to offer valuable insights based on their interactions or experiences with specific care providers. Your ultimate aim is to ensure the comfort, safety and happiness of your loved one under the care of the chosen provider.

How expensive is private respite care in the UK?

In the United Kingdom, the cost of private respite care can fluctuate considerably, primarily based on two main aspects: the intensity of care required and the duration for which the care is needed.

The average cost for respite care is between £700 and £1,500 per week. Bear in mind, though, that this is simply a broad estimate. The cost isn't the same for everyone and can depend largely on individual needs.

For instance, some people might only need care for a handful of hours per day, while others might have to bear the expense of ongoing, round-the-clock care, which inevitably increases the cost. In addition to the period and level of care needed, other factors might affect the cost as well. Your location within the UK or the specific services required from the care provider can drive the price up or down.

Moreover, the qualifications of the carers, their experience and the type of care needed (medical or non-medical) are also contributing factors to the overall cost of private respite care. Despite these numerous variables and the complex nature of costing, it's always recommended to directly reach out to a prospective provider.

By doing this, you'll be able to acquire a more precise quote that would be specifically tailored to your requirements. Communication with providers will also allow you to get a deeper understanding of what's included in the service, eliminating any uncertainty about the cost.

Is private respite care worth it?

Private respite care is undoubtedly worth it and provides numerous benefits, not just for those being cared for but also for their loved ones acting as caregivers. Its worth stems from its role in offering the vital intermission required by family members looking after their loved ones, consequently ensuring continuous professional care for those needing it while keeping their usual routine intact.

When taking care of a loved one becomes part of the daily routine, stress and burnout for family caregivers are bound to occur. Here, private respite care steps in by providing the crucial opportunity for family caregivers to take a step back, rest, rejuvenate, and recover.

This not only safeguards their physical health but also their mental wellbeing. By doing so, caregivers can return to their duties replenished and with renewed vigour, which can undeniably lead to a more satisfying and improved quality of care.

In addition to providing relief to caregivers, private respite care also enhances the quality of life for the person receiving the care. The elderly, in particular, can gain significantly from the personalised and well-tailored services that private respite care offers. By catering to their comprehensive needs, private respite care guarantees comfort, safety, and a better state of overall well-being for the elderly.

Above all, the reassurance that your loved ones are under the supervision of capable, professional caregivers when you are not around is priceless. Knowing that no matter what, there is someone dependable to look after the well-being of your loved ones brings about a sense of peace and serenity, which in turn reduces anxiety and stress. This peace of mind truly underscores the value of private respite care, making it a worthy investment and hence, emphasises its worthwhileness.
